The Newspaper Proprietors’ Association of Nigeria , has given a November 1, 2021, deadline for its members to constitute an internal ombudsman mechanism in their various organisations.

Yusuf said that “steps are being quickened to empanel at the industry level, a workable, quick and responsive system to address public complaints and concerns on missteps by the media and its operatives.” He added that the internal ombudsman would also “ensure that the public’s right to know is protected.”
